Job Description
br>The Trade Marketing Manager is responsible for developing and executing marketing strategies that drive product visibility, increase sales, and strengthen brand presence in retail and distribution channels. This role bridges marketing and sales, ensuring that promotional activities are effective and aligned with business goals.
Key Responsibilities:
Develop and execute trade marketing plans for different sales channels
Coordinate with sales teams to design promotional activities for key accounts
Manage budgets for trade marketing initiatives and ensure cost efficiency
Conduct market analysis to identify trends, competitor activities, and growth opportunities
Oversee the creation of point-of-sale materials and merchandising displays
Build strong relationships with retailers, distributors, and trade partners
Monitor, evaluate, and report on trade marketing performance metrics

There are two Chevron companies operating in the Philippines: Chevron Holdings Incorporated (CHI) and Chevron Philippines Incorporated (CPI).
CHI is a shared services center providing transactional, processing, and consulting services in the areas of finance and accounting, information technology, supply chain management, human resources, downstream customer service and marketing. Established in 1998, CHI serves Chevron affiliates in six continents around the world. Over the years, it has grown to be one of the leading members of the shared services industry in the Philippines.
CHI has received various recognitions as a top employer: the 2022 Diversity Company of the Year; 2021 Asia's Best Employer Brand Award; 2021 Global Best Employer Brand Award; 2020 HR Asia Best Companies to Work for in Asia; 2019 Circle of Excellence, Top Employer Category at Asia CEO Awards, and the 2018 Wellness Company of the Year at the same Asia CEO Awards.
CPI markets the Caltex brand of top-quality fuels, lubricants, and petroleum products through a network of service stations, terminals and sales offices.
